Feisar
Bold Monday · Paul van der Laan · 2000

An outline typeface evolved from a 12-pixel bitmap UI font, blending 1970s sci-fi, 1980s gaming and 1990s techno aesthetics into a recognisable display face.
About
Originally designed as a pixel-grid bitmap font for a game interface, Feisar has been redrawn as a scalable outline family with five weights from ExtraLight to Bold. Paul van der Laan reinterpreted the pixel-grid constraints rather than simply tracing them, which gives the face its particular legibility at display sizes despite its retro-techno character. Best suited to titles, gaming interfaces and projects that need a deliberately period-coded digital flavour.
